The Capanna Punta Penia mountain hut is the highest mountain hut in the Dolomites, situated at 3,343 metres on the Marmolada in the municipality of Canazei (TN).

The Emilio Comici mountain hut, or Emilio-Comici-Hütte in German, is situated at 2,153 metres above sea level, at the foot of the main face of the Sassolungo and near Piz Sella (2,284 m), above the village of Plan de Gralba, a hamlet of Selva di Val Gardena.

The Torre di Pisa Mountain Hut (2,671 m) is the only mountain hut situated in the heart of the Latemar mountain range (Dolomites), on the summit of Cavignon, in Val di Fiemme - Predazzo (TN)
The route around the Tre Cime di Lavaredo is one of the most beautiful hikes in the Dolomites, a must-see destination for mountain lovers. The route is considered suitable for those with some experience of high-altitude hiking, with a total elevation gain of around 250 metres, which takes 3–4 hours to complete. This broad estimate takes into account the fact that the route is very popular with hikers of varying abilities, each at their own pace.
The hike from Passo Pordoi to Cima Piz Boè is a real adventure in the Dolomites, perfect for those who want to put their legs to the test and enjoy spectacular scenery. Starting from Passo Pordoi (2,239 m), follow trail 627 to Forcella Pordoi (2,848 m), where you’ll find the Forcella Pordoi mountain hut, a perfect spot for a refreshing break with hot food and breathtaking views of the Marmolada.

SELLARONDA BIKE DAY - 06.06 and 12.09.2026
Saturday, 06.06.2026 and Saturday, 12.09.2026 from 8:30 a.m. to 4:00 p.m. all the Dolomite passes around the Sella (Sella, Pordoi, Campolongo, Gardena) will be reserved for cyclists.
